Chimney Inspection Service in San Francisco, CA
Chimney in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a chimney’s condition to ensure safe and efficient operation. These inspections typically cover the exterior and interior components, including the flue, chimney structure, and any related venting systems. Homeowners often request inspections before the start of the heating season, after a chimney has experienced damage, or if they are planning a fireplace renovation. Understanding the current state of a chimney helps identify potential issues such as blockages, cracks, or creosote buildup that could pose safety risks or impact performance.
Property owners usually want to know what specific areas will be examined during the inspection and whether any repairs or maintenance might be necessary. It’s common to inquire about signs of deterioration, the presence of obstructions, or damage caused by weather or pests. Having a clear understanding of the inspection process can help homeowners make informed decisions about maintaining their chimney and ensuring it functions properly and safely throughout the year.

Common Chimney Inspection Service Jobs
Chimney Inspection - a thorough assessment of the chimney’s condition and safety.
Flue Inspection - checking for blockages, cracks, and creosote buildup inside the chimney flue.
Pre-Season Inspection - evaluating the chimney before the heating season begins to ensure proper function.
Post-Repair Inspection - confirming repairs have been completed correctly and the chimney is safe to use.
Emergency Inspection - assessing damage after a chimney fire or storm to identify hazards.
Ventilation Inspection - ensuring proper airflow and proper venting for fireplaces and appliances.
Chimney Inspection Service Questions
What is involved in a chimney inspection? A chimney inspection assesses the condition of the flue, chimney structure, and venting systems to identify potential issues or blockages.
How often should a chimney be inspected? It is recommended to have a chimney inspected annually, especially if it is used frequently or shows signs of wear.
What signs indicate a chimney needs inspection? Signs include smoke odors, drafts, soot buildup, or visible damage such as cracks or corrosion.
What are the benefits of a professional chimney inspection? A professional inspection helps ensure safe operation, prevents fire hazards, and prolongs the life of the chimney system.
